  1. Brillante Mendoza (Tagalog: [brɪlˈjantɛ mɛnˈdɔsɐ]; born July 30, 1960), also known as Dante Mendoza, is a Filipino independent filmmaker. Mendoza is known one of the key members associated with the Philippine New Wave.

  2. Brillante Mendoza. Director: Alpha: The Right to Kill. Brillante Mendoza is a Philippine director and producer. He is the first Filipino to receive the Best Director award at Cannes for his film Kinatay in 2009.
